Electrical/Electronic Engineering


• Electronic hardware (digital, microprocessor and analogue disciplines)


Typical skills required include:


  • Knowledge of motor control, drive, bus, RF and embedded microcontroller systems
  • Analogue signal processing
  • Machine control system electrical design
  • PLC integration and programming
  • Understanding of principles of designing for EMC compatibility and other legislative standards
  • Ability to work within a structured ISO9001 environment
  • Familiarity with UK Ministry of Defence working procedures
  • Capacity to produce structured project documentation




Mechanical Engineering


• Mechanical Engineering 3D CAD Designers

Typical required knowledge spans:


  • Solid Edge and AutoCAD
  • Overall system and detail design
  • Transmission and drive systems
  • Material selection and cost-effective design
  • Sheet metal fabrications
  • Turned and milled components
  • Casting and moulding design
  • RoHS and WEEE requirements
  • Design Documentation to BS 8888-2004
  • Ministry of Defence standards




Software


• Software Engineers

Typically requires experience in the following areas:


  • Real time embedded systems using C
  • Data communications including CAN, RS485 and Ethernet
  • Low level interfaces such as SPI and I2C
  • Development of high level MS Windows applications using C++ and C#
  • Knowledge of Winsock and networking principles
  • Working within a structured ISO 9001/TickIT environment
  • Documentation and testing using formal methods
  • PLC programming
  • Four and six axis robotic programming
